| CalculateColSplitDistributionOfLayer(vector< typename DER::LocalIT > &divisions3d) | combblas::SpParMat3D< IT, NT, DER > | |
| CalculateColSplitDistributionOfLayer(vector< typename DER::LocalIT > &divisions3d) | combblas::SpParMat3D< IT, NT, DER > | |
| CalculateColSplitDistributionOfLayer(vector< typename DER::LocalIT > &divisions3d) | combblas::SpParMat3D< IT, NT, DER > | |
| CheckSpParMatCompatibility() | combblas::SpParMat3D< IT, NT, DER > | |
| CheckSpParMatCompatibility() | combblas::SpParMat3D< IT, NT, DER > | |
| CheckSpParMatCompatibility() | combblas::SpParMat3D< IT, NT, DER > | |
| Convert2D() | combblas::SpParMat3D< IT, NT, DER > | |
| Convert2D() | combblas::SpParMat3D< IT, NT, DER > | |
| Convert2D() | combblas::SpParMat3D< IT, NT, DER > | |
| FreeMemory() | combblas::SpParMat3D< IT, NT, DER > | |
| FreeMemory() | combblas::SpParMat3D< IT, NT, DER > | |
| FreeMemory() | combblas::SpParMat3D< IT, NT, DER > | |
| getcommgrid() const | combblas::SpParMat3D< IT, NT, DER > | inline |
| getcommgrid() const | combblas::SpParMat3D< IT, NT, DER > | inline |
| getcommgrid() const | combblas::SpParMat3D< IT, NT, DER > | inline |
| getcommgrid3D() const | combblas::SpParMat3D< IT, NT, DER > | inline |
| getcommgrid3D() const | combblas::SpParMat3D< IT, NT, DER > | inline |
| getcommgrid3D() const | combblas::SpParMat3D< IT, NT, DER > | inline |
| GetLayerMat() | combblas::SpParMat3D< IT, NT, DER > | inline |
| GetLayerMat() | combblas::SpParMat3D< IT, NT, DER > | inline |
| GetLayerMat() | combblas::SpParMat3D< IT, NT, DER > | inline |
| getncol() const | combblas::SpParMat3D< IT, NT, DER > | |
| getncol() const | combblas::SpParMat3D< IT, NT, DER > | |
| getncol() const | combblas::SpParMat3D< IT, NT, DER > | |
| getnnz() const | combblas::SpParMat3D< IT, NT, DER > | |
| getnnz() const | combblas::SpParMat3D< IT, NT, DER > | |
| getnnz() const | combblas::SpParMat3D< IT, NT, DER > | |
| getnrow() const | combblas::SpParMat3D< IT, NT, DER > | |
| getnrow() const | combblas::SpParMat3D< IT, NT, DER > | |
| getnrow() const | combblas::SpParMat3D< IT, NT, DER > | |
| GlobalIT typedef | combblas::SpParMat3D< IT, NT, DER > | |
| GlobalIT typedef | combblas::SpParMat3D< IT, NT, DER > | |
| GlobalIT typedef | combblas::SpParMat3D< IT, NT, DER > | |
| GlobalNT typedef | combblas::SpParMat3D< IT, NT, DER > | |
| GlobalNT typedef | combblas::SpParMat3D< IT, NT, DER > | |
| GlobalNT typedef | combblas::SpParMat3D< IT, NT, DER > | |
| isColSplit() const | combblas::SpParMat3D< IT, NT, DER > | inline |
| isColSplit() const | combblas::SpParMat3D< IT, NT, DER > | inline |
| isColSplit() const | combblas::SpParMat3D< IT, NT, DER > | inline |
| isSpecial() const | combblas::SpParMat3D< IT, NT, DER > | inline |
| isSpecial() const | combblas::SpParMat3D< IT, NT, DER > | inline |
| isSpecial() const | combblas::SpParMat3D< IT, NT, DER > | inline |
| LoadImbalance() const | combblas::SpParMat3D< IT, NT, DER > | |
| LoadImbalance() const | combblas::SpParMat3D< IT, NT, DER > | |
| LoadImbalance() const | combblas::SpParMat3D< IT, NT, DER > | |
| LocalDim(IT total_m, IT total_n, IT &localm, IT &localn) const | combblas::SpParMat3D< IT, NT, DER > | |
| LocalDim(IT total_m, IT total_n, IT &localm, IT &localn) const | combblas::SpParMat3D< IT, NT, DER > | |
| LocalDim(IT total_m, IT total_n, IT &localm, IT &localn) const | combblas::SpParMat3D< IT, NT, DER > | |
| LocalIT typedef | combblas::SpParMat3D< IT, NT, DER > | |
| LocalIT typedef | combblas::SpParMat3D< IT, NT, DER > | |
| LocalIT typedef | combblas::SpParMat3D< IT, NT, DER > | |
| LocalNT typedef | combblas::SpParMat3D< IT, NT, DER > | |
| LocalNT typedef | combblas::SpParMat3D< IT, NT, DER > | |
| LocalNT typedef | combblas::SpParMat3D< IT, NT, DER > | |
| MemEfficientSpGEMM3D | combblas::SpParMat3D< IT, NT, DER > | friend |
| MemEfficientSpGEMM3D | combblas::SpParMat3D< IT, NT, DER > | friend |
| MemEfficientSpGEMM3D | combblas::SpParMat3D< IT, NT, DER > | friend |
| Mult_AnXBn_SUMMA3D | combblas::SpParMat3D< IT, NT, DER > | friend |
| Mult_AnXBn_SUMMA3D | combblas::SpParMat3D< IT, NT, DER > | friend |
| Mult_AnXBn_SUMMA3D | combblas::SpParMat3D< IT, NT, DER > | friend |
| Owner(IT total_m, IT total_n, IT grow, IT gcol, LIT &lrow, LIT &lcol) const | combblas::SpParMat3D< IT, NT, DER > | |
| Owner(IT total_m, IT total_n, IT grow, IT gcol, LIT &lrow, LIT &lcol) const | combblas::SpParMat3D< IT, NT, DER > | |
| Owner(IT total_m, IT total_n, IT grow, IT gcol, LIT &lrow, LIT &lcol) const | combblas::SpParMat3D< IT, NT, DER > | |
| PrintInfo() const | combblas::SpParMat3D< IT, NT, DER > | |
| PrintInfo() const | combblas::SpParMat3D< IT, NT, DER > | |
| PrintInfo() const | combblas::SpParMat3D< IT, NT, DER > | |
| seqptr() const | combblas::SpParMat3D< IT, NT, DER > | inline |
| seqptr() const | combblas::SpParMat3D< IT, NT, DER > | inline |
| seqptr() const | combblas::SpParMat3D< IT, NT, DER > | inline |
| SpParMat3D(int nlayers) | combblas::SpParMat3D< IT, NT, DER > | |
| SpParMat3D(const SpParMat< IT, NT, DER > &A2D, int nlayers, bool colsplit, bool special=false) | combblas::SpParMat3D< IT, NT, DER > | |
| SpParMat3D(DER *myseq, std::shared_ptr< CommGrid3D > grid3d, bool colsplit, bool special=false) | combblas::SpParMat3D< IT, NT, DER > | |
| SpParMat3D(const SpParMat3D< IT, NT, DER > &A3D, bool colsplit) | combblas::SpParMat3D< IT, NT, DER > | |
| SpParMat3D(int nlayers) | combblas::SpParMat3D< IT, NT, DER > | |
| SpParMat3D(const SpParMat< IT, NT, DER > &A2D, int nlayers, bool colsplit, bool special=false) | combblas::SpParMat3D< IT, NT, DER > | |
| SpParMat3D(DER *myseq, std::shared_ptr< CommGrid3D > grid3d, bool colsplit, bool special=false) | combblas::SpParMat3D< IT, NT, DER > | |
| SpParMat3D(const SpParMat3D< IT, NT, DER > &A3D, bool colsplit) | combblas::SpParMat3D< IT, NT, DER > | |
| SpParMat3D(int nlayers) | combblas::SpParMat3D< IT, NT, DER > | |
| SpParMat3D(const SpParMat< IT, NT, DER > &A2D, int nlayers, bool colsplit, bool special=false) | combblas::SpParMat3D< IT, NT, DER > | |
| SpParMat3D(DER *myseq, std::shared_ptr< CommGrid3D > grid3d, bool colsplit, bool special=false) | combblas::SpParMat3D< IT, NT, DER > | |
| SpParMat3D(const SpParMat3D< IT, NT, DER > &A3D, bool colsplit) | combblas::SpParMat3D< IT, NT, DER > | |
| ~SpParMat3D() | combblas::SpParMat3D< IT, NT, DER > | |
| ~SpParMat3D() | combblas::SpParMat3D< IT, NT, DER > | |
| ~SpParMat3D() | combblas::SpParMat3D< IT, NT, DER > | |